OUTSTANDING PERFORMERS, BAND AND ORCHESTRA The concert band, in its second year of existence as such at Dondero, expanded its membership by some 25 freshmen. As only four seniors graduated last June and but five in 1958, this augmented the band to almost 70 musicians. A highly com- petitive group, the concert band is entered only by audition. Extra rehearsals were a necessity with the bands tightly- packed schedule. At 7:15 A.M. the practice rooms in the new wing which houses the music rooms were a iumble of sound as the various sections rehearsed individually to gain the polish necessary for a fine performance. Often the entire band rehearsed at this hour, making the near-empty halls THE ORCHESTRA which boasts a bass section of three Cone not picturedj, poses for our photographer before entering the pit echo. Their assiduous efforts resulted in a prized superior rating in district competition, the first such rating in Dondero's history. In its second year under the able baton of their director, Mr. Yenovk Kavafian, the orchestra enlarged both its membership and scope. Recruiting'wind instrument players from the concert band, the group gave two concerts, one in coniunction with the band, at which it skillfully performed works by Haydn, Vivaldi, and Mozart. Entering the contest, the first time and Royal Oak orchestra has done so, they also earned a first division fsuperiorj rating.
